The gutsy decision by AT&T(NYSE: T) today to withdraw from actively
marketing traditional consumer local and long-distance services highlights
the seismic shift that has been long underway within the telecom market.
Nemertes repeatedly has stressed the growing distinction between "bandwidth
providers," which offer commodity (and often, legacy) services and "service
providers," which specialize in ensuring effective delivery of services to
defined customer groups.
